Revolutionizing Transportation: The Rise of Blockchain Autonomous Cars

As technology continues to advance at a rapid pace, the concept of autonomous cars powered by blockchain technology is gaining traction in the automotive industry. Blockchain, the decentralized and secure digital ledger technology behind c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in, is now being integrated into the development of self-driving cars to enhance their functionality and security.
One of the key benefits of blockchain technology in autonomous cars is its ability to securely store and transfer data in a tamper-proof manner. This is essential for self-driving vehicles, as they rely on a vast amount of data to navigate and make real-time decisions on the road. By using blockchain technology, autonomous cars can securely store data such as sensor readings, GPS coordinates, and vehicle-to-vehicle communications, ensuring that the information is accurate and cannot be altered by external sources.
In addition to data security, blockchain technology also enables greater transparency and accountability in the operation of autonomous cars. Each transaction or decision made by the vehicle is recorded on the blockchain, allowing for a complete audit trail of its actions. This can be particularly useful in the event of an accident or a dispute, as the blockchain can provide an accurate record of what the vehicle did leading up to the incident.
Furthermore, blockchain technology can facilitate peer-to-peer transactions between autonomous cars, allowing them to communicate and negotiate with each other in real-time. This could potentially lead to more efficient traffic flow, as vehicles can coordinate with each other to optimize routes and avoid congestion. Additionally, blockchain-enabled autonomous cars could also participate in car-sharing or ride-sharing services, with payments and transactions handled securely through the blockchain.
As the development of blockchain autonomous cars continues to progress, there are still challenges to overcome, such as regulatory hurdles, cybersecurity concerns, and public acceptance. However, the potential benefits of this technology are vast, from increased road safety and efficiency to greater accessibility for individuals with disabilities or limited mobility.
